Chelford Parish Council

Chelford Parish Council is an elected body which is the first tier of local government and acts to represent the interests of the community.  The Parish Council consists of ten elected Parish Councillors who meet on a regular basis to determine what actions should be taken to promote and protect the interests of Chelford residents.

Parish Councillors are elected every four years, however, there may be additional opportunities to join the Parish Council should a casual vacancy arise.  Parish Council elections and casual vacancies are advertised on the Parish Council notice boards and on this website.
